Chanté Joseph's viral Vogue article has sparked a global debate: why are women obscuring their partners online, sharing only a hand or a blurred face?
We unpack the shifting script where public partnership can feel cringe, and how the new flex is independence.
And in headlines today, The Victorian Supreme Court has released the documents relating to Erin Patterson’s murder conviction appeal revealing her team believes a substantial miscarriage of justice has occurred; An academic has warned the Liberal party that women are watching how they treat their leader as Sussan Ley continues to fight to keep her leadership position; French authorities have started proceedings to suspend online fast-fashion retailer Shein days after weapons and childlike sex dolls were found being sold on its site; US singer Jelly Roll has called out a Sydney store for poor treatment after he attempted to spend some down time from performing doing some retail therapy
